About the Item
An exceptional pair of hand-carved console tables in solid walnut, crafted in Tuscany in the late 17th century. These elegant consoles feature refined semicircular tops supported by boldly sculpted lyre-shaped legs, joined by a central stretcher that adds both stability and visual harmony. The craftsmanship is immediately apparent in the fluid curves and bold silhouettes, which evoke the rustic sophistication of Italian Baroque design.
Though originally conceived as wall-mounted consoles, their design offers unique versatility: when placed together, the two halves form a complete circular table—perfect for occasional dining, intimate gatherings, or as a sculptural centerpiece. The deep, warm patina of the walnut highlights the natural grain and lends a rich sense of age and authenticity.
Equally striking when used individually or combined, these pieces are both functional and sculptural, ideal for those seeking timeless character with the soul of 17th-century Italian craftsmanship. A rare and adaptable addition to both traditional and modern interiors.

Early 18th Century Italian Fratino Table in Walnut, Umbrian Origin
Located in Atlanta, GA
A stately Umbrian fratino table in solid walnut, dating circa 1720. This early 18th century refectory table features a rectangular top with a finely carved dentil edge, a subtle yet elegant detail that enhances its architectural presence.
The table is supported by bold lyre-shaped legs, each ending in a graceful scroll and connected by a sculptural curved stretcher, which adds both stability and visual rhythm to the piece. Rich in patina, the walnut displays warm, honeyed tones and natural grain movement that speak to centuries of history and craftsmanship.
Originally used in monasteries or noble residences, this table embodies the simplicity and solidity of traditional Italian design while offering timeless beauty and functionality. Ideal as a dining table, console, or statement piece in a grand hallway, this rare Umbrian example captures the soul of 18th century Italian furniture...
